WebServices y Proxy

20/05/2004 - 21:16 por Victor Velasquez | Informe spam
Tengo una pequeña gran duda, en mi universidad nos conectamos a internet por
por medio de un proxy http, si yo desarrollo una aplicacion que se conecta a
un webservice en que parte o como le hago para que pueda ingresarle el proxy
y su puerto? y tambien tener la opcion de conexion directa a internet?

Saludos.

Víctor Manuel Velásquez C.
Microsoft Certified Professional
Universidad de Antioquia
Medellin, Colombia

Preguntas similare

Leer las respuestas

#1 A.Poblacion
21/05/2004 - 08:28 | Informe spam
Primero declaras una variable del tipo de la clase que expones a través del
webservice, y luego le asignas el proxy a su propiedad Proxy:

MiEspaciodenombres.MiClase servicio = new MiEspaciodenombres.MiClase();
servicio.Proxy = new WebProxy("http://servidor:8080", true);
servicio.MiFuncion();


From: "Victor Velasquez"
Newsgroups: microsoft.public.es.csharp
Sent: Thursday, May 20, 2004 9:16 PM
Subject: WebServices y Proxy


Tengo una pequeña gran duda, en mi universidad nos conectamos a internet


por
por medio de un proxy http, si yo desarrollo una aplicacion que se conecta


a
un webservice en que parte o como le hago para que pueda ingresarle el


proxy
y su puerto? y tambien tener la opcion de conexion directa a internet?

Saludos.

Víctor Manuel Velásquez C.
Microsoft Certified Professional
Universidad de Antioquia
Medellin, Colombia


Respuesta Responder a este mensaje
#2 Victor Velasquez
21/05/2004 - 18:32 | Informe spam
Listo, pero si lo que necesito hacer es lo siguiente:



String URLString = "http://msdn.microsoft.com/rss.xml";

string news = " MSDN News"; int a;

// Load the XmlTextReader from the URL

XmlTextReader reader = new XmlTextReader (URLString);



En donde deberia especificar el proxy?, como le haria para copiar la
configuracion de proxy que tiene IE?



Gracias!


Saludos.

Víctor Manuel Velásquez C.
Microsoft Certified Professional
Universidad de Antioquia
Medellin, Colombia
"A.Poblacion" wrote in
message news:
Primero declaras una variable del tipo de la clase que expones a través


del
webservice, y luego le asignas el proxy a su propiedad Proxy:

MiEspaciodenombres.MiClase servicio = new MiEspaciodenombres.MiClase();
servicio.Proxy = new WebProxy("http://servidor:8080", true);
servicio.MiFuncion();


From: "Victor Velasquez"
Newsgroups: microsoft.public.es.csharp
Sent: Thursday, May 20, 2004 9:16 PM
Subject: WebServices y Proxy


> Tengo una pequeña gran duda, en mi universidad nos conectamos a internet
por
> por medio de un proxy http, si yo desarrollo una aplicacion que se


conecta
a
> un webservice en que parte o como le hago para que pueda ingresarle el
proxy
> y su puerto? y tambien tener la opcion de conexion directa a internet?
>
> Saludos.
>
> Víctor Manuel Velásquez C.
> Microsoft Certified Professional
> Universidad de Antioquia
> Medellin, Colombia
>
>


Respuesta Responder a este mensaje
#3 A.Poblacion
21/05/2004 - 18:59 | Informe spam
"Victor Velasquez" dijo:
En donde deberia especificar el proxy?



En teoría se debe de poder hacer como sigue, pero nunca lo he probado con un
XmlTextReader:

WebProxy proxyObject = new WebProxy("http://webproxy:80/");
GlobalProxySelection.Select = proxyObject;


como le haria para copiar la configuracion de proxy que tiene IE?



Me imagino que debe haber alguna API que te devuelva la configuración de
proxy de IE, pero no la conozco. Alguna vez que me ha hecho falta, he
recurrido a una pequeña chapuza consistente en buscar en el Registro de
Windows el sitio donde IE graba la configuración de Proxy y leerla
directamente de ahi.
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ida